About This Product

Low-Profile Electric Floor Heating

Warmup® StickyMat electric floor heating mats use a twin-conductor heating cable pre-spaced on fiberglass mesh for fast, consistent installation. The system delivers 14 W/sq. ft. while maintaining a low 1/8" profile and is designed to provide primary heating when installed over a properly insulated subfloor.

Self-Adhesive Mat for Faster Installation

The 20" wide mesh features double-sided tape and pressure-sensitive adhesive to hold the mat in position during installation. The pre-spaced cable eliminates manual cable spacing while allowing the mesh to be positioned around the room layout without cutting the heating cable.

Tile, Stone, Vinyl, Carpet and Wood Floors

StickyMat is suitable beneath tile, stone, porcelain, vinyl, LVT, glued-down carpet, and glued-down wood. Compatible subfloors include plywood, OSB, concrete slabs, cement boards, polymer-modified leveler, and cementitious-coated insulation boards. The system requires 3/8" to 3/4" of thinset or self-leveling compound coverage.

ETFE-Insulated Heating Cable

The heating cable uses advanced ETFE fluoropolymer insulation on the conductors and outer jacket for protection within the floor assembly. Each mat is fully grounded and includes a 10 ft. power lead for connection to the electrical supply.

Thermostat Control and Primary Heating

StickyMat can be controlled with the Warmup 4iE® Programmable Thermostat for scheduled floor heating and power-use monitoring. For primary heating applications, Warmup recommends adequate subfloor insulation and Warmup Insulation Boards over uninsulated slabs on grade.

Can Warmup StickyMat be used as the primary heat source?

Yes. StickyMat is designed to provide primary heating when the subfloor is properly insulated. Warmup recommends additional insulation over uninsulated slabs on grade.

Can the StickyMat heating cable be cut?

No. The heating cable must not be cut. The mesh can be positioned as needed to accommodate the room layout without cutting or damaging the heating cable.

How much thinset or self-leveling compound should cover the mat?

Warmup specifies a minimum coverage of 3/8" and a maximum coverage of 3/4" of thinset or self-leveling compound.
